Ryman raises $700M for Grande Lakes deal, but financing was already expected

$700M senior notespriced in
6.250% notes due 2035
Ryman Hospitality Properties, Inc. (RHP) — what happened, in plain English, and what it means versus what the market expected.

The market already knew the financing plan. Ryman announced the Grande Lakes acquisition on August 10, 2026, and the proposed $700 million notes offering on August 11, so this filing mainly confirms execution rather than introducing a new transaction.

The debt leg is now in place. The issuers sold $700 million of 6.250% senior notes due 2035.

ItemFiling detail
Senior notes issued$700 million (Indenture)
Coupon / maturity6.250% / 2035 (Indenture)
Grande Lakes purchase priceApproximately $1.38 billion (Use of proceeds)
Equity raised previously5,865,000 shares at $117.00 per share (Use of proceeds)
Mandatory redemption if deal fails100% of issue price plus accrued interest (Special mandatory redemption)

The transaction remains dependent on closing, not financing availability. Ryman intends to use the proceeds for part of the approximately $1.38 billion purchase price, with the remainder funded by the completed equity offering and cash on hand.

The net read is neutral because this is confirmation, not incremental upside. The filing removes one execution step and makes the capital structure more concrete, but it also adds fixed interest expense and unsecured debt; it provides no new operating projections, leverage metric, acquisition economics, or closing confirmation to change the previously understood investment picture.
